What’s A Tattoo?
A tattoo is a type of human physique modification or everlasting ornament that’s finished by a needle inserting ink into the dermis (the second layer) of the pores and skin. The phrase comes from a Polynesian phrase: Ta, which suggests “to strike.” The phrase ultimately developed into the Tahitian phrase tatau, which suggests “to mark one thing.”
Tattoos are utilized in many various methods. They could be used as a small ornament on the higher arm or as a big work of tattoo artwork like a chest piece, half-sleeve tattoo, leg tattoo, or leg sleeve. They could seem on all totally different elements of the physique, together with the genitals. They are often made up of vibrant colours or be so simple as a reputation inscribed with black ink.
A Quick Historical past of Tattoos
Tattoo use goes again to historic instances after they had been utilized in Egypt as early as 2040 B.C. Historic Greeks and Romans used tattoos as a type of punishment and likewise to mark criminals and prisoners of conflict. It made these people straightforward to establish in the event that they occurred to flee.
Sure native cultures additionally used tribal tattoos to establish who was “certainly one of them.”
Tattoos was once seen as a cultural taboo—related to insurrection or particular teams of individuals, like jailed criminals, gang members, and even the army. They often had a sure stigma hooked up to them and had been typically appeared upon with raised eyebrows—significantly when younger folks received their first one. Nevertheless, their reputation has been growing during the last couple of many years.
Athletes and celebrities have been one affect within the enhance. Nevertheless, tattoos are additionally generally used to cowl up surgery-related or injury-related scars.
A survey finished in 2004 discovered that 24% of individuals between the ages of 18 and 50 had tattoos, and one other 21% stated they’d thought-about getting one. A newer survey finished in 2015 with a bigger group (2,225 folks) discovered that the tattooed group had elevated to 29%.
Issues With Conventional Tattoos
Conventional tattoos aren’t essentially innocent phrases or photographs in your physique. There are a lot of issues round what will get injected into your pores and skin and the way it will have an effect on your physique long-term. Listed below are a few of the issues round conventional tattoos:
- Most cancers-causing ink – Black tattoo ink is the most typical colour utilized in tattooing. It’s additionally very excessive in cancer-causing elements, like benzo(a)pyrene. The Worldwide Company for Analysis on Most cancers (IARC) lists benzo(a)pyrene as a carcinogen. A 2018 assessment research listed 51 publications and 63 most cancers instances related to tattoos. Black, blue, and purple inks had been probably the most cancer-promoting.
- Allergic reactions to ink – When you’re delicate to different chemical compounds or topical elements, watch out for tattoo ink. The dyes utilized in tattoos are filled with artificial elements that would trigger an allergic response. A lot of the reactions are to purple ink, however folks can also react to the cadmium in yellow ink, chromium in inexperienced ink, and cobalt in blue ink.
- Contamination with microorganisms – In Might of 2019, the FDA despatched out a Security Advisory to shoppers, tattoo artists, and retail outlets warning that some inks had been contaminated with micro organism and had been recalled. Infections from these inks may result in allergic reactions, rashes, or lesions and will trigger everlasting scarring.
- Injury to the pores and skin – Bacterial infections can result in blemishes within the pores and skin, resulting in everlasting scarring. Typically keloids (unpleasant scar tissue) additionally type as a response to the tattoo ink. They generally want surgical procedure to take away them. Inks could also be made up of metal-containing compounds, akin to paraphenylenediamine, which may trigger points with pores and skin pigment.
- Tattoos can affect sweating – You are likely to lose extra sodium and electrolytes in tattoo-covered areas. This in all probability gained’t make a distinction should you simply have a small tattoo right here or there. Nevertheless, important ink protection can get in the way in which of regular sweating, shedding a few of the well being advantages of perspiration.
- Unknown long-term results – The FDA has famous that, though analysis is ongoing, we nonetheless don’t know all of the potential long-term results of tattoos. Whereas folks report lots of the opposed reactions instantly, some results don’t occur till years later.
The toxicity resulting in allergic reactions, cancers, and unknown long-term results comes from the truth that tattoo inks are filled with chemical compounds. Listed below are just some (there could also be as much as 100 totally different substances in any given ink):
- Solvents, like ethanol, isopropyl alcohol (rubbing alcohol), glycerin, and propylene glycol – The solvents are in all probability the most secure of the elements
- Emulsifiers, quite a lot of esters
- Binders, like Polyethers, polyvinylpyrrolidone, block-copolymer, and shellac
- Anti-foaming brokers, like polydimethylsiloxane
- Preservatives, like parabens, phenols, formaldehyde, methylisothiazolinone, and petrochemicals
- Metals, like nickel, cobalt, chromium, cadmium, and mercury. (Mercury could also be a hidden contributor to candida overgrowth)
- Microorganisms, like Staphylococci, Streptococci, and Pseudomonas subspecies
- Nanoparticles, particularly in black ink. These nanoparticles can enter the bloodstream and create toxicity all through the physique.
Sadly, most individuals don’t know tattoos pose any danger to them healthwise. A survey of over 200 folks was revealed within the Journal of Medical and Aesthetic Dermatology in 2018. Researchers needed to search out out what folks knew concerning the medical dangers of tattoo ink.
The research included each those that’d gotten tattoos and people who had not. The common age was 26.9 years. Of the questions on well being dangers, over 50% of the solutions had been answered incorrectly. Clearly, folks don’t totally perceive tattoo dangers and problems.

Vegan Tattoos
Vegan tattoos are made with none animal-based elements, akin to glycerin from animal fats. As an alternative, they use plant-based glycerin. The colours are additionally free from animal and even insect-based elements or dyes, like shellac, which comes from beetles.
Vegan ink takes its colours from pure plant- and mineral-based sources, for instance:
- Black dye from carbon and logwood
- White dye from titanium dioxide
- Purple dye
- Blue dye from sodium, copper, and aluminum
- Inexperienced dye from monoazo, from carbon
- Yellow dye from turmeric
- Crimson dye from naphthol
As a result of the dyes come from pure elements, they’re much less prone to trigger points with toxicity, allergic reactions, and most cancers.
What About Henna?
Henna is a well-liked alternative for these curious about pure magnificence. This tattoo possibility comes from India. Henna is produced from a tropical flowering plant that’s grown in Africa and Asia. The henna is dried, floor right into a paste, and used as a dye. It could be used as a tattoo, hair dye, or colorant for silk, wool, or leather-based.
The great factor about henna is that it’s not everlasting. It solely lasts for a few weeks at most. Henna sits on the floor of the pores and skin—the dermis, somewhat than the dermis. Whereas it looks as if it could be safer as a result of it’s pure and short-term, the FDA has issued a warning about short-term tattoos.
Henna dye might not be fully pure and pure. Conventional henna could also be high-quality, however now one thing referred to as “black henna” is in style. So-called “black henna” is commonly a mix of henna and different elements, like a hair dye containing the chemical p-phenylenediamine (PPD). Typically “black henna” doesn’t even comprise henna. As an alternative, it’s simply the PPD hair dye. PPD is dangerous to the pores and skin, and by regulation, it will possibly’t be utilized in cosmetics. It’s vital to do your analysis in your henna artist to make sure you are receiving pure henna.
Natural Tattoos
Are there actually natural tattoos? Not in the way in which that you just would possibly suppose. There’s no USDA-organic tattoo ink. “Natural” is a method of tattooing. The time period doesn’t discuss with pure elements however the design. “Natural” refers back to the parts which might be utilized by the tattoo artist in creating the design.
Natural tattoo designs embrace pure parts from the earth, animals, birds, bones, claws, and human anatomy, together with the digestive system, particular person organs, muscle tissue, tendons, and bones. It’s in style amongst followers of science fiction.
For a lot of throughout the natural group, biomechanical tattoos (or “biomech tattoos”) are additionally in style. These sci-fi-looking tattoo ideas embrace machine elements, typically mixed with the natural concept to create an natural cyborg tattoo.

Tattoo Ideas
When you determine to get a tattoo (or add to your assortment), listed here are some tricks to be sure to have the most effective and most secure expertise:
- Discover a respected place – Do your analysis forward of time and discover a licensed, respected tattoo studio.
- Verify hygienic practices – When getting your tattoo, watch to ensure the ability makes use of good hygiene and sterilizes chairs, work surfaces, and gear between purchasers. Additionally, be sure your artist washes his or her arms and dons a recent pair of gloves earlier than beginning. Needles must be taken from a brand new, sealed bundle.
- Ensure that correct care is taken of pores and skin beforehand – Your pores and skin must be correctly cleaned with a disinfectant like rubbing alcohol earlier than tattooing.
- Care for your tattoo afterward – New tattoos ought to solely be bandaged for 1 or 2 hours. After eradicating the bandages, apply a pure antibiotic cream or perhaps a colloidal silver spray. Afterward, gently clear the world with cleaning soap and water and gently pat dry.
- Control it – Ensure that the world is clear and freed from an infection. For the primary few days, hold the world moisturized with shea butter, jojoba oil, or a light unscented cream. (If you wish to DIY, strive this one.)
- Give it time to heal – It may well take two weeks in your pores and skin to heal after a tattoo. Which means the pores and skin goes to be delicate and fragile for some time. Keep away from touching the tattooed space and keep away from direct solar publicity till it heals.
